What Is a Blackjack Calculator?
A Blackjack Calculator is a powerful tool designed to help players optimize their blackjack strategy. It analyzes the cards dealt, considers your hand versus the dealer’s visible card, and recommends the best possible move—whether to hit, stand, double down, or split. Unlike guessing or relying solely on memorization of strategy charts, these calculators provide real-time guidance to help you make smarter decisions at the table.
Blackjack Calculators are available in various formats, including mobile apps, online tools, or even as built-in features in advanced betting software. They’re particularly effective for beginners learning the ropes of blackjack strategy, but they can also help intermediate and advanced players spot mistakes or refine their decision-making skills.
How Does a Blackjack Calculator Work?
To understand how a Blackjack Calculator works, it’s essential to know the key principle blackjack is built upon—minimizing the house edge by making statistically optimal decisions. Blackjack Calculators are crafted with algorithms based on mathematical models and strategy charts. Here’s a simple breakdown of the process:
- Input Your Hand and Dealer’s Card: You enter your current hand and the dealer’s upcard into the calculator.
- Analysis of Available Moves: The calculator evaluates all possible actions—hitting, standing, splitting, or doubling down—based on probability.
- Optimal Strategy Suggestion: It provides you with the move that has the best chance of maximizing your winnings or minimizing your losses.
For instance, if you’re dealt a soft 17 (Ace + 6) and the dealer shows a high card like a Queen, the calculator may recommend hitting rather than standing, as the odds favor trying to improve your hand in this scenario.

Common Misconceptions About Blackjack Calculators
Despite their benefits, several misconceptions surround Blackjack Calculators. Here are a few myths debunked:
- “They Guarantee Wins”: A Blackjack Calculator improves your decision-making but doesn’t change the randomness of the cards dealt. Luck is still a significant factor in blackjack.
- “They’re Only for Beginners”: While they are great for new players, experienced players can also use calculators to fine-tune their strategies.
- “Using One Is Cheating”: Blackjack Calculators are legal in most contexts outside of live casinos, but always check the rules before using one.
